If you are an employee who would like to gain valuable work-related skills but do not have a lot of money to shell out on expensive courses, or an employer who would like to help an employee gain those skills, the Chillicothe & Ross County Public Library has a great FREE system that can help.

Gale Courses have returned to the local library system. It's a online learning platform that offers access to hundreds of instructor-lead on courses on a variety of business skills and services such as Microsoft Excel, Word, PowerPoint, Project and more. They also have specific courses on studying_online.jpgsales, supervision and management, customer service, social media, project management and more.

Leadership and management and business software are two particular areas of developmental courses that Gale Courses offer free of charge. There are even classes that can strengthen non-profit businesses, particularly a slew of grant writing classes that could help your organization get money for your valuable services.
